keen-slider vs Flickity

Struggling to choose between keen-slider and Flickity? Both products offer unique advantages, making it a tough decision.

keen-slider is a Development solution with tags like slider, carousel, accessibility, vanilla-js.

It boasts features such as Lightweight, Performant, Accessible, Customizable, Vanilla JavaScript, Highly customizable, Works for simple sliders to complex carousels, Touch swipe support, Keyboard controls and pros including Lightweight with no dependencies, Smooth performance, Accessible out of the box, Very customizable, Vanilla JS so works with any framework, Good for simple and complex use cases, Supports touch and keyboard.

On the other hand, Flickity is a Photos & Graphics product tagged with carousel, slider, responsive, touch, images, gallery, flickable.

Its standout features include Touch support and mobile optimization, Responsive and adaptive design, Flickable transitions between slides, Multiple slider types like carousels, galleries, etc, Lightweight and dependency-free, Customizable with CSS, Accessible and semantic markup, Works with images, videos, text, etc, Supports lazy loading, Integrates with React, Vue, Angular, etc, and it shines with pros like Easy to set up and use, Very customizable, Good performance, Lots of documentation and support, Active development and maintenance, Wide browser support, Lightweight footprint, Good for both images and other content types.

To help you make an informed decision, we've compiled a comprehensive comparison of these two products, delving into their features, pros, cons, pricing, and more. Get ready to explore the nuances that set them apart and determine which one is the perfect fit for your requirements.

keen-slider

keen-slider

Keen Slider is a lightweight, performant, accessible and customizable vanilla JavaScript slider. It is highly customizable and works well for simple sliders to complex carousels. It has touch swipe support and keyboard controls built-in.

Categories:
slider carousel accessibility vanilla-js

Keen-slider Features

  1. Lightweight
  2. Performant
  3. Accessible
  4. Customizable
  5. Vanilla JavaScript
  6. Highly customizable
  7. Works for simple sliders to complex carousels
  8. Touch swipe support
  9. Keyboard controls

Pricing

  • Open Source

Pros

Lightweight with no dependencies

Smooth performance

Accessible out of the box

Very customizable

Vanilla JS so works with any framework

Good for simple and complex use cases

Supports touch and keyboard

Cons

Less features than some heavier sliders

Requires some CSS

Not as beginner-friendly as some options

May require more customization for complex uses


Flickity

Flickity

Flickity is a popular JavaScript library for creating responsive, touch-friendly image carousels and sliders. It enables smooth, flickable transitions between images and adapts gracefully to any screen size.

Categories:
carousel slider responsive touch images gallery flickable

Flickity Features

  1. Touch support and mobile optimization
  2. Responsive and adaptive design
  3. Flickable transitions between slides
  4. Multiple slider types like carousels, galleries, etc
  5. Lightweight and dependency-free
  6. Customizable with CSS
  7. Accessible and semantic markup
  8. Works with images, videos, text, etc
  9. Supports lazy loading
  10. Integrates with React, Vue, Angular, etc

Pricing

  • Open Source

Pros

Easy to set up and use

Very customizable

Good performance

Lots of documentation and support

Active development and maintenance

Wide browser support

Lightweight footprint

Good for both images and other content types

Cons

Less features than some other sliders

Relies on CSS for some functionality

Not as flexible as building custom slider

May need polyfills for older browser support

Not as suitable for huge numbers of items

Limited to horizontal scrolling